Transcripts and Mail.
While we continue to accept traditional, mailed transcripts and forms, it's generally no longer the fastest way for us to receive your important documents. If possible, please have official transcripts sent electronically from your other institutions as we receive them faster and they are more easily tracked. Additionally, for transcripts from Millersville, please make any transcript requests electronically for official PDF transcript which will be electronically sent. Electronic transcripts allow us to provide faster, more efficient service.

ONLINE MAINTENANCE PERIOD NOTICE
Monday evenings between 6 pm-10 pm is a maintenance period during which some electronic forms may not be accessible/available. If you are trying to access a form during this time, please try back again outside of this time frame before submitting a notice of form failure. This maintenance period applies to many of the forms and items accessed through MAX and the registrar's office.
NOTICE from the Office of Student Accounts
Students who register are responsible to drop any class they do not plan to attend. Failure to drop the class before the semester begins may result in charges and/or grades being posted to your records. Do not rely on the "drop for non-payment" policy to remove these classes.
